The Role of Gamification in Enhanced Engagement
Gamification techniques, such as points, badges, and leaderboards, have become commonplace in digital entertainment, and for good reason. They tap into intrinsic human motivations, providing a sense of accomplishment and encouraging continued participation. However, effective gamification goes beyond simply adding superficial rewards. It should be integrated seamlessly into the core experience, enhancing rather than distracting from the inherent enjoyment of the activity. A well-designed gamification system recognizes and rewards a wide range of behaviors, not just winning or achieving high scores. Encouraging exploration, collaboration, and creativity are all valuable aspects of a thriving player community. Ultimately, gamification should serve as a tool to unlock a player’s potential and encourage them to delve deeper into the available experiences.

The Importance of Moderation and Safety
Creating a positive and safe community requires diligent moderation. This involves proactively identifying and addressing inappropriate behavior, such as harassment, spam, and malicious content. Clear guidelines and transparent enforcement are essential to establishing a culture of respect and accountability. However, moderation shouldn't be overly restrictive, stifling legitimate expression or hindering open discussion. The goal is to strike a balance between protecting players and fostering a thriving community atmosphere. Providing tools for players to report inappropriate behavior and empowering them to block or mute unwanted interactions are also crucial elements of a comprehensive safety strategy. A secure and welcoming environment builds trust and encourages greater participation.

Leveraging Data to Optimize the Player Journey
The wealth of data generated by player interactions provides invaluable insights into their behavior and preferences. Analyzing this data can reveal patterns, identify pain points, and inform strategic decisions. For example, understanding which content is most popular, how players progress through different levels, and where they encounter difficulties can help optimize the platform’s design and content offerings. A/B testing different features and functionalities can also provide valuable data, allowing for continuous improvement. However, it's crucial to handle player data responsibly, adhering to privacy regulations and ensuring transparency. Players should have control over their data and be informed about how it's being used. Ethical data practices build trust and foster a positive relationship with the player base.
Predictive Analytics and Personalized Recommendations
Beyond simply analyzing past behavior, predictive analytics can be used to anticipate future needs and proactively offer personalized recommendations. By identifying players who are likely to churn, platforms can intervene with targeted promotions or incentives to encourage continued engagement. Similarly, by predicting which content a player is most likely to enjoy, platforms can deliver personalized recommendations that enhance their experience. This level of personalization requires sophisticated algorithms and a deep understanding of player psychology. The Role of Technology in Delivering Seamless Experiences
The underlying technology plays a crucial role in delivering a seamless and enjoyable player experience. Scalability is paramount, ensuring the platform can handle peak traffic without performance degradation. Reliability is equally important, minimizing downtime and ensuring consistent availability. Choosing the right technology stack is a critical decision, and factors such as cost, security, and maintainability must all be considered. Cloud-based solutions offer numerous advantages, providing scalability, flexibility, and cost-effectiveness. Investing in robust infrastructure and prioritizing technical excellence are essential for long-term success. Furthermore, optimizing the platform for different devices and screen sizes is crucial, ensuring a consistent experience across all platforms.
